In a world addicted to speed, noise, and performance, How to Stay Human is your weekly reminder to slow down, feel deeply, and live with soul. Hosted by award-winning author and integrative guide Tori Gordon and abundant futurist Kyle Herron, this podcast explores what it means to lead a fully human life in an increasingly artificial world. Tori Gordon
Tori Gordon is a transformational guide and spiritual teacher who focuses on personal growth, mental health, and self-improvement. She brings a heartfelt, story-rich approach to episodes, promoting a deeper understanding of the human experience.
Kyle Herron
Kyle Herron acts as a consciousness strategist and technologist, integrating modern inquiry with spiritual awakening. He serves a complementary role to Tori, guiding discussions that bridge ancient wisdom with contemporary challenges.

Frequently Asked Questions About How to Stay Human

What is How to Stay Human about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Focused on exploring the intersection of spirituality, personal growth, and technology, this podcast encourages listeners to reconnect with their humanity amid an increasingly artificial and disconnected world. Hosted by Tori Gordon and Kyle Herron, episodes are rich in storytelling and feature insightful conversations with a variety of guests ranging from mystics to modern thought leaders. Noteworthy themes include spiritual awakening, nervous system healing, and the complexities introduced by artificial intelligence, all framed as a journey towards integrating ancient wisdom with contemporary experiences.
